Start a blog or website and monetize it through advertising, affiliate marketing, or selling digital or physical products.
Offer freelance services such as writing, editing, graphic design, or social media management.
Sell products or services through an e-commerce platform, such as Etsy, eBay, or Shopify.
Create and sell an online course or e-book.
Sell stock photos or videos to websites or individuals.
Become a virtual assistant and offer administrative, technical, or creative assistance to clients remotely.
Offer consulting or coaching services through a website or online platform.
Monetize a YouTube channel through advertising revenue, sponsorships, and product placements.
Create and sell print-on-demand products, such as t-shirts or mugs, through a platform like Printful.
- Participate in paid online surveys or focus groups.
It's important to note that making money online requires dedication, hard work, and persistence. It's not a get-rich-quick scheme and success may not happen overnight. It's also important to thoroughly research any opportunity before committing to it and to be aware of potential scams.
